Context
Two video surveillance products are entering development at Vizzia: video-based traffic enforcement, with a first deployment in the UK, and ANPR, automatic number plate recognition run on legal request. Both rely on the same technical chain: camera-equipped units in the field, an edge to cloud pipeline, and a SaaS that officers use every day. That chain has to be built.
Vizzia equips more than 250 local authorities for waste management today. Safety is the company's second product line, and it comes with its own constraints: data hosted in France on SecNumCloud infrastructure, evidential integrity, end to end traceability.
The team is small and senior. You will join Jérémy Fornarino, Tech Lead, as the second backend engineer on Safety. Your mission: take ownership of a significant share of the backend for both products, across the full edge and cloud spectrum, and raise the team's quality bar alongside him.
What You'll Do
1. The edge backend
Build and operate the services running on the field units: camera communication (VAPIX, ISAPI, ONVIF), NX Witness integration, local SQLite storage.
Optimise CPU and RAM on units with limited resources, and minimise the 4G/5G bandwidth of the video chain without degrading the user experience.
Debug a unit in production: SSH, logs, incident triage across the fleet.
2. The cloud backend
Design and operate the Hono APIs, the event-driven workers on the LavinMQ bus, and the Postgres/Drizzle data layer.
Drive the fleet from the cloud, orchestrate processing, and guarantee resynchronisation after a network outage with no data loss.
Deploy and operate: GitHub Actions, Helm, GKE, Datadog monitoring and alerting.
3. Ship enforcement and ANPR to production
Co-own both projects from technical spec through to production, working with the PM and the legal constraints of the domain: evidential integrity, audit trail, retention and purge, GDPR.
Architect the shared ingestion and edge to cloud layer that both products converge on.
Be one of the two backend leads on production incidents, able to handle an edge or cloud incident on your own.
4. Architecture and quality
Write your own ADRs, challenge Jérémy's, and be challenged in return.
Ship every module tested, harden the critical parts of the existing code (workers, pipelines), and let CI catch regressions rather than customers.
Keep to the monorepo conventions: moon, bun, ten bounded contexts.
Current stack: TypeScript end to end, bun, Hono, Drizzle, Postgres on the cloud side, SQLite on the edge, LavinMQ bus, moon monorepo, GKE, Datadog. Infrastructure and DevOps experience is welcome but not a prerequisite, you can pick it up here.
Who You Are
4 to 8 years of backend experience, a significant part of it in SaaS.
TypeScript/Node in production, operational from day one. The rest of the stack is quick to learn on a solid foundation.
You have built and operated event-driven distributed systems in production: message buses, workers, idempotency, retries, with the structured logging, monitoring and incidents that come with them.
An engineering degree or a master's.
Curiosity about systems, networks and protocols. An unusual camera protocol or a unit stuck in a crashloop is the fun part of the job for you, not the scary one.
AI coding tools are part of how you work, and the quality holds up.
Two bonus profiles, not prerequisites: video and streaming experience (codecs, containers, VMS), or a background in IoT, embedded or robotics. Domain knowledge can make up for a shorter SaaS track record.
At Vizzia we work in a small team, with a lot of ownership and few silos. We are looking for someone who picks up topics without waiting, argues their choices, and genuinely cares about the problems the public sector is trying to solve.
